About the Conference
The 29th Annual Conference of the Society of Statistics, Computer and Applications (SSCA) on “Navigation of Statistical Sciences, Artificial Intelligence and Machine Learning for Sustainable Ecosystem” (NAVSTAT-2027) is a comprehensive three-day event, aiming at providing an international forum for statisticians, data scientists, agricultural researchers, financial analysts, and interdisciplinary experts to discuss recent developments in statistical sciences and their integration with Artificial Intelligence and Machine Learning for understanding and managing complex hill ecosystem data. The focus is on the fusion of statistical inference, Bayesian methods, multivariate analysis, stochastic processes, non-parametric techniques, financial statistics, econometric analysis and time series modelling with intelligent computational approaches for analyzing quantitative and qualitative data arising from agriculture, climate, public health, food, nutrition systems, and socio-economic domains.
About the Host Institute & Department
Dr. Y.S. Parmar University of Horticulture and Forestry (YSP UHF): Nauni – Solan, Himachal Pradesh, India, established in 1985, is the first Horticulture and Forestry University in Asia engaged in teaching, research and extension education in horticulture, forestry and allied sciences. The university has played a key role in making Himachal ‘The Apple State of India’ by providing quality planting material and advanced technologies.
Department of Basic Sciences: Comprises five major disciplines: Microbiology, Statistics, Plant Physiology, Biochemistry, and English. YSPUHF is the only university in Himachal Pradesh offering post-graduate degree programmes in (Agri) Statistics, M.Sc. and Ph.D. programmes in (Agri) Microbiology, (Agri) Plant Physiology, and (Agri) Biochemistry.
